1997 Vauxhall Corsa passenger rear indicator not working

Car: Vauxhall Corsa
Year: 1997
Variant: 1.2 breeze manual
Categories: Electrics, ECU, Warnings & Lights
Hi i have a problem with the rear indicator on passenger side.it comes on and then goes off, everytime the block fits into the light, i have replaced the light block and changed the bulb, but still no joy. any help would be grateful thank you.

you need to check the bulb holder for damage/corrosion and make sure connector block to light is makeing a good connection and the earth connection is ok have you got correct bulb some have ofset pins later models had a problem with flasher unit ie bulbs flashing fast on one side

thanks for the help. yes i have changed the bulb holder, all other lights in the bulb holder working fine its just the indicator thats not working.

you will have to remove plug to light unit and using a test lamp and assistant earth test lamp to body and see if there is feed to indicator terminal have done a few cars and connector plug has been the problem but sourced one from breakers yard cut off and soldered replacement on just a point does it work with hazard lights on if it does it could be stalk that is problem
